The Schitt's Creek cast swept up a ton of awards during the Emmys on Sunday, but it wasn't the first win for Eugene Levy and Catherine O'Hara. The longtime friends, who play onscreen couple Johnny and Moira Rose on the hit series, have been working together since the '70s and actually earned their first Emmy together. In 1982, they took outstanding writing in a variety or music program for their work on the Canadian television sketch comedy show Second City Television.

While they already have Emmys for writing, their recent wins at the 2020 award show marks their first acting Emmys — Eugene took home outstanding lead actor in a comedy series and Catherine nabbed outstanding lead actress in a comedy series. The cast also took home outstanding comedy series. Talk about full circle! In honor of their big night, we couldn't help but relieve their first Emmy win.
